Tom Brady

Thomas Edward Patrick Brady Jr., born August 3, 1977, in San Mateo, California, transformed from a sixth-round draft pick into the greatest quarterback in NFL history. Growing up in the San Francisco Bay Area, Brady idolized Joe Montana and attended 49ers games at Candlestick Park. Despite his passion for football, college recruitment attention proved limited, and he eventually committed to the University of Michigan.

Mike Evans

Mike Evans, born on August 21, 1993, in Galveston, Texas, is a standout wide receiver in the NFL, known for his size, speed, and catching ability. He played college football at Texas A&M University, where he caught the attention of scouts with his dynamic playmaking skills. Selected by the Tampa Bay Buccaneers in the first round of the 2014 NFL Draft, Evans quickly became a key component of the team's offense. He has consistently put up impressive numbers each season and has established himself as one of the premier receivers in the league, earning multiple Pro Bowl selections and setting several franchise records. Evans is praised for his ability to make contested catches and stretch the field vertically. His contributions were vital in the Buccaneers' Super Bowl LV victory, solidifying his legacy as a clutch performer. Off the field, Evans actively engages in community service, focusing on helping local youth through various programs.
